NEMA fines developer Sh250,000 over illegal construction

The National Environment Management Authority (NEMA) has waded into the contested development of a four-acre piece of land belonging to Kenya Railways by a private developer in Nairobi's Industrial Area.

The authority yesterday fined Mumodi Logistics Ltd, the private developer, Sh250,000 for operating without relevant approval and ownership documents following a site inspection visit.
